Ticket: config drift detected on the Quotaforge per-tenant rate limiter. Staging and production disagree on burst allowances for three tenant tiers, likely from a hotfix applied directly to prod during the Brindlewick incident. Please review the diff carefully — the limiter silently clamps unknown keys, so typos won't fail loudly. The intended canonical values, which prod should match after the fix, are as follows.

settings of fafog-haduf:
ZORIX_PIN=4648
ZORIX_METRICS_HOST=metrics.zorix.paliqsys.corp
ZORIX_LOG_LEVEL=info
ZORIX_TENANT=druix

Q2 Planning Note — Launch Plan for the Hollis Pro Line

Hi sales leads — quick rundown before planning week. The Hollis Pro launches in week 7, starting with the Ostermark and Calveny regions, then national four weeks later. Demo kits ship to branches by week 5, and Marnie Tethers is running enablement sessions the week before. Pricing lands slightly above the old Hollis Classic, with a bundle promo for the first sixty days. Targets are in the planning deck. The confidential competitive angle we're playing is noted just below.

management briefing: Only 46 of the 419 pilot accounts renewed Tammir, so a churn review is set for July 7. Norwynix Partners is in early talks to buy Aldaxix Freight for about $100.6 million.

## Further reading

The `keyturner` utility handles scheduled rotation of service credentials across all Brindlewood environments. It runs as a daily job, swaps secrets in the vault, and triggers rolling restarts of affected services. Most of what new team members need is in this README, but the deeper material — rotation policies, grace-period semantics, and the emergency manual-rotation procedure — lives elsewhere. Start with the architecture overview and FAQ, which you'll find on our internal documentation page.

dashboard of bahaf-tageg = https://jira.zemvarlabs.internal/projects/projects/browse/projects